Sliema is a beautiful city in Malta

with stunning beaches, a rich history and cultural heritage, and modern urban amenities. Here's a travel guide to Sliema, Malta, to help you have a wonderful trip:

Attractions

- Sliema Front: This promenade stretches along the coastline and is a great place for walking, jogging, and cycling. Along the way, there are many restaurants, cafes, and bars where you can enjoy the beautiful sea views.

- St. Julian's: Sliema's neighbor, St. Julian's, is a vibrant city with many restaurants, bars, and nightclubs. In addition, there are some beautiful beaches, such as Exiles Bay and St. George's Bay.

- Valletta: The capital of Malta, Valletta, is a historic city with many ancient buildings and museums. You can visit the Upper Barrakka Gardens, the Lower Barrakka Gardens, and St. John's Co-Cathedral.

Food

- Rabbit Stew: One of Malta's traditional dishes, rabbit stew is usually cooked with red wine, onions, carrots, and potatoes, resulting in a rich flavor.

- Seafood Pasta: As a coastal city, Sliema offers seafood pasta as one of its local specialties. You can choose your favorite seafood, such as shrimp, crab, or shellfish, to be stir-fried with pasta.
